Description
Reporting to the Supply Chain Manager, the position holder's main responsibility is the strategic management of the site’s entire logistics and transportation department and it’s personnel. Their role also includes promoting and applying Glatfelter's values and rules, particularly in terms of health and safety, quality, customer service, and continuous improvement.
Tasks and Responsibilities
- Analyze and monitor the effectiveness of the services under their supervision to maintain a high level of performance and reliability (technical and financial).
- Optimize storage, transportation, and handling processes and strategies across the company's various sites.
- Manage inventories (efficiency of the FIFO process, inventory reliability process and management of reject inventories from various storage sites).
- Negotiate certain service contracts with the support of their superior and/or the purchasing group.
- Manage the departmental HSE plan, promote workplace health and safety within the group, and take action on various departmental risks.
- Support members of their management team (4 employees) in achieving their performance objectives.
